Dos and Don’ts in Treating Sinusitis Naturally

Sinusitis can be provoked by infection of the sinuses, or seasonal allergies. Infection can be bacterial or viral, and it also can be acute or chronic. If it lasts more than 12 weeks we are usually talking about the chronic one, while in the case of several days to weeks it is an acute one. Doctors usually treat sinusitis with antibiotics. Antibiotics work to reduce the amount of bacteria in your system and your white cells will try to clear the infection. In the case of viral infection, we have to rely on our immune systems alone.

But is there something that we can do to actually help?

Yes, there is. We must remember, when we're suffering from sinusitis, not to consume food and drinks, especially drinks, which act as diuretics. Diuretics drain the fluids from our body. They cause the dehydration of the nasal membrane, which can increase discomfort and pain. The most widely and most frequent used diuretics are coffee and other caffeinated drinks, as well as alcohol. Actually, the opposite would be quite helpful – drinking plenty of water can dilute the mucus in the sinuses and improve drainage. relieve sinusitis with hydration Also, avoid foods that cause acid reflux. Dairy products and sugars (beware of the juices with added sugar) can also worsen sinusitis. Another good way of treating sinusitis naturally is to increase the humidity in the sinuses. We can do that by using a saline nasal spray, which you can make at home, or by using Neti Pot which will not only add humidity, but it can rinse out mucus and help in relieving congestion as well. Simply breathing in the steam of herbal tea is also a very good way to add humidity. Here is an unusual but natural solution... try eating horseradish.
